House of Fraser
House of Fraser, a chain of department stores in the United Kingdom. It was founded in Glasgow, Scotland in 1849. A series of acquisitions has made it one of the biggest retailers in the United Kingdom. By the end of the 1980s, it had more than 90 stores. But it had lost traction with British customers who were shifting away from big-scale department stores to more trendier shops.
House of Fraser began a program to renovate and downsize its stores in the early 1990s. It also opened new stores. The company was hoping to acquire smaller rival Allders, but that deal was not able to be completed.
Mike Ashley has brought about a number of changes to the company. It has, for instance, introduced augmented reality on its magazine covers and catalogues. The feature lets readers scan the cover using their smartphones and view virtual representations of the clothes and products featured in the article. It also includes a "shoppable" window feature.
John Lewis
John Lewis is the UK's largest department store chain with stores across England and Scotland. The flagship store of the company is located in Birmingham's Grand Central shopping centre. The store covers an area of 250,000 square feet and houses the John Lewis own-brand collection.
John Spedan Lewis founded the company in 1864 when the first store he opened was on Oxford Street in London. Today, the John Lewis Partnership is one of the largest businesses owned by employees in Britain. It owns Waitrose and John Lewis department stores as in addition to a variety of suburban and province department stores.
The Partnership has struggled with its recovery from the expansion it faced in the 2000s, when it competed with discount stores such as Lidl and Aldi. Dame Sharon White has overseen a turnaround strategy, and the CEO Nish Kankiwala has pledged to concentrate "unashamedly on retail." The company is also investing in the latest digital technologies. The chain is known for offering excellent customer service and its employees are well-known for their high levels of pay.
